Non-Profit - Nashville, TN, US
Tennessee World Affairs Council is a nonpartisan, nonprofit educational association that seeks a well-informed community that thinks critically about the world and the impact of global events. It does so through distinguished speaker programs, seminars, Webinars, Podcasts and educational outreach programs in high schools and universities.The Council is a member of the 90+ network of similarly focused world affairs councils. It is hosted by Belmont University where most of its in-person events are held. A regular program of Webinars and Podcasts (2-3 week) connect our community with foreign ambassadors and other diplomats, business leaders, military officers, scholars and other specialists. The Academic WorldQuest program for high school students inspires interest in global affairs through weekly quizzes, scholar certificate programs and a state-wide tournament with the champions advancing to a national match and a tour of Washington, DC foreign interest institutions.The TNWAC is a membership organization and welcomes everyone.
